RATIFY THE LAW OF THE SEA
The Earth from space is a soft collage of green, blue, brown and white. National borders are not visible, but the vast oceans and seas, which make up over two-thirds of the Earth's surface, are. 155 countries have ratified the Law of the Sea, a treaty that sets international guidelines for the oceans, the common heritage of mankind. It is past time for the U.S. to ratify the Law of the Sea and join this important community of nations.
Peace, Equity, and Security. No one nation controls the world's vast oceans. Only through a comprehensive set of rules can all nations profit fairly and sustainably from the ocean's resources and maintain their rights to navigate safely and freely.
We Shouldn't Be Left Out in the Arctic Cold. Joining the Law of the Sea will give us a seat at the table so we can voice our concerns with other nations. We can't sit on the sidelines anymore.
Senators Who Oppose the Convention are Out of Touch. The president, the military, environmental groups, and all major ocean industries support the treaty. The small minority who may vote against the Law of the Sea offer no alternative and are out of the mainstream.
